Trust vs Mistrust
Infants learn to trust caregivers to provide basic needs.
Autonomy vs Shame and Doubt
Develop a sense of independence or experience shame/doubt about themselves
Initiative vs guilt
children take on activities and social interaction
industry vs inferiority
Children begin to have a sense of pride in their work and abilities
Identity vs Role confusion
Adolescents explore their independence and sense of self or they become confused about their identity.
Intimacy vs isolation
Young adults form intimate loving relationships or they face isolation
Generativity vs stagnation
adults strive to create or nurture things that will outlast them, or they feel unproductive and uninvolved
Ego Integrity vs despair
Older adults reflect on their life, feeling a sense of fulfillment, or they are filled with regret and bitterness
Sensorimotor Stage
0-2, learn through senses and actions key is object permanence.
preoperational stage
2-7 years, symbolic thought and imaginitive play
concrete operational stage
7-11 children start to think more logically about concrete events
formal operational stage
12 +, gain the ability to reason hypothetically
